Introduction to Bitpie Wallet
Bitpie Wallet is a digital asset management wallet based on blockchain technology, designed to provide users with secure and convenient storage, trading, and exchange services for cryptocurrencies. Its interface is simple and user-friendly, supporting a variety of mainstream digital currencies. Users can not only manage their assets through Bitpie Wallet, but also conduct trades and exchanges.

Exchange between fiat currency and cryptocurrency
Theoretical Basis
The exchange between fiat currencies (such as RMB, USD, etc.) and cryptocurrencies (such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, etc.) typically relies on exchanges. Users can purchase cryptocurrencies with fiat currencies on these exchanges, or convert cryptocurrencies back into fiat currencies. The exchange rate is determined by market supply and demand and fluctuates at any time.

The answer to whether Bitpie Wallet supports fiat currency exchange is yes. Users can exchange between fiat currencies and cryptocurrencies within the Bitpie Wallet. This feature provides great convenience for users, especially as digital currencies are becoming increasingly popular nowadays.
In fact, Bitpie Wallet often collaborates with some major exchanges to enable the possibility of fiat currency exchange. When making an exchange, users can choose to connect directly to these exchanges through the Bitpie Wallet for convenient transactions.
